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
664723 19 701 28620 24689
46210 68679446565
46210 68679446565
26506591 915 4265 39105
All about undefined
Interested in learning more?
46210 68679446565
26506591 915 4265 39105
See more
5608080 20962 74762
1179 625 15146216 264679 7062346
See more
214281 21
042 39 038800409
See more